1989
Self-taught in guitar playing
-
1990 – 1995
Co-founded the hard rock band Big Bang with Mário Nagy (Martin Máček – vocals, Slavo Sršeň – bass guitar)
-
1990 – 1991
Jazz guitar course (taught by Dano Morvay)
-
1996
Recorded songs by Jimi Hendrix (with bassist Miro Dvorský) and participated in a Jimi Hendrix song interpretation competition in North Carolina (USA) – won 2nd place in the semifinal round as the best European participant
-
1997 –
Collaboration with renowned guitar maker Milan Číž
-
1995 – 1998
Member of the band René Band (René Lacko – guitar, vocals; Milan Golha – bass guitar; Mário Nagy – drums), focused on blues-rock in the style of Stevie Ray Vaughan
-
1998
René & Downtown Band (Jozef Bobula – bass guitar), performed at the Pepsi Sziget festival and in Paks (Hungary)
-
1999
Occasional performances with Miro Dvorský’s Blues Rock Circus; unplugged concerts with Jozef Engerer
-
1999 – 2002
Club performances in Germany, jam sessions with guitarist Matthias Baumgardt (DE) and his band O’Colors; René & Downtown Band opened for Mick Taylor in Bratislava
-
2001
Participation in the Memorial Evening SRV in Budapest; meetings with blues guitarist Zsólt Benkö
-
2002 – 2003
Guest appearances with the band Freemen from Prievidza; performance at Blues Alive in Šumperk
